Right. Here it is - its in an older version of Word so it should be ok. I haven't attached it, but there is a front sheet with our logo on, a photograph of the child and the child's name and date of birth. Overleaf there is a statement of what the six areas of learning and development are, broken down into the aspects. There is a brief explanation of how it should be used, including a statement explaining that the document is not designed to be used as a ticklist in order to identify what children can't do!

Hi have something simular but am trying to work out how and when to fill it out. HELP please!!!!!!!!!!!!!!

We analyse our children's observations and write the dates of those obs against any of the statements which are evidenced by what the child did or said. We'll then highlight the statements when we feel there is ample evidence that the child has met this stepping stone/statement.

Just before we broke up I was visited by our CSC (child support co-ordinator) who I questioned about the EYFS because apart from a briefing which seemed like ages ago there has not been any training etc. I told her my ideas I had thought about from reading the pack, I asked about doing learning journeys in a scrap book style and she said I didn't need to do that. Also, here in West Sussex we are still waiting for the development records to be delivered and was told to carry on using the old ones just as long as I could show where it all tied in with the new EYFS...........confused!!!!!!!

 

 

So this is what we plan to do/use:

long term planning....showing festivals, celebrations, visits, special events etc

 

no medium term

short term planning.....weekly being led from the children's interests.

 

observations........snap shot (recorded on post its)

photographic observations....for individual children's records

 

each child to have their own profile....using Maz's form which will also include their development record when available! and the following learning journeys for parents to keep updated between open evenings.
